Overview

Postcode B37 7NL is located in a major urban area, within the Chelmsley Wood ward of Solihull in the West Midlands region, and forms part of the Chelmsley Wood West area. It has very high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 277.1 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, roughly 2.9× the West Midlands average of 97 per 1,000. The average income per household in Chelmsley Wood West is £40,567 per year. The nearest station is Marston Green, about 1.1 miles away. There are 6 primary and 4 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, the closest large park is Meriden Park.

Deprivation level

10/10

Chelmsley Wood West has a very high level of deprivation, ranked at position 1,399 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the top 4% most deprived areas in England.

Crime level

10/10

Chelmsley Wood West has a very high crime rate, with approximately 277.1 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.

Social housing

50.4%

Approximately 50.4%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 51.1% of dwellings are socially rented.

Income level

2/10

The average income per household in Chelmsley Wood West is £40,567 per year.

Noise Level

Low

Low noise level (55.0-59.9 dB) from road, approximately 0 ft away from B37 7NL.

Flood risk

No risk

Chelmsley Wood West near B37 7NL has no fl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.

Transport

The nearest station is Marston Green located about 1.1 miles away. There are no other stations nearby.
